Chapter 1
Chapter context: The Excellence of Promoting Greetings
- باب فضل السلام والأمر بإفشائه
View in chapterHadith text
Original Arabic
وعن أبي يوسف عبد الله بن سلام رضي الله عنه قال: سمعت رسول الله صلى الله عليه وسلم يقول:
يا أيها الناس أفشوا السلام، وأطعموا الطعام، وصلوا الأرحام وصلوا والناس نيام، تدخلوا الجنة بسلام
((رواه الترمذي وقال حديث حسن صحيح)).
Translation
English translation
'Abdullah bin Salam (May Allah be pleased with him) reported:
I heard the Messenger of Allah (ﷺ) saying, "O people, exchange greetings of peace (i.e., say: As-Salamu 'Alaikum to one another), feed people, strengthen the ties of kinship, and be in prayer when others are asleep, you will enter Jannah in peace." [At- Tirmidhi, who classified it as Hasan Sahih].
